PAULMAN v. FILTERCORP, INC.

No. 61857-7.

127 Wn.2d 387 (1995)

899 P.2d 1259

HENRY PAULMAN, Respondent, v. FILTERCORP, INC., Petitioner.

The Supreme Court of Washington, En Banc.

August 10, 1995.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Law Offices of Michael Charneski by Michael L. Charneski, for petitioner.

Cairncross & Hempelmann by John McKay and Sandra Meadowcroft, for respondent.

Daniel B. Ritter on behalf of Washington Bankers Association, amicus curiae.


DOLLIVER, J.

Defendant Filtercorp, Inc., challenges a Court of Appeals ruling that reverses a trial court order granting Filtercorp's partial summary judgment motion, which requested, inter alia, that the court terminate a collection action initiated by Plaintiff Henry Paulman because the interest rate on the loan that gave rise to the action is usurious.
